Output d0c2e42c4ec6e7eca05bc84f24dd7e8937063383ea13d8623de93e2f843059c6:0

value
123168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57e478f3eb5f604a1b56e302821980c3d9c0d1cc OP_EQUAL
address
39hkQn7dKDJYMqpJ7rY4x1X34osEfZHCbh
transaction
d0c2e42c4ec6e7eca05bc84f24dd7e8937063383ea13d8623de93e2f843059c6
confirmations
396688
spent
true